Output 586975970c5b6a9bd7aea92449155a246d7ed1c5ffc44d0dcb010a5d4dc31392:26

value
11980532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b26f791b32ecc561ef598196d9a76081d0082e OP_EQUAL
address
3DEvpdGsezQhw3z2qLFNwcbyPJp9ToFQAq
transaction
586975970c5b6a9bd7aea92449155a246d7ed1c5ffc44d0dcb010a5d4dc31392
spent
true